Output 218801d76a6ff481a68ede3d685350521880cfe83f6df067a2688e3aa32723d0:12

value
939880
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40cc3505c416838933c304d43d7131776fef3140 OP_EQUAL
address
37bdoP1YDrWowWVeaZJn7ReeFGFLLCFruW
transaction
218801d76a6ff481a68ede3d685350521880cfe83f6df067a2688e3aa32723d0
spent
true